A Guide to Video Object Segmentation for Beginners

Segmenting and tracking the objects of interest in the video is critical for effectively analyzing and using video big data.
Video segmentation, or the partitioning of video frames into multiple segments or objects, is important in a variety of practical applications, including visual effect assistance in movies, autonomous driving scene understanding, and video conferencing virtual background creation, to name a few.
